  • A fine little coil! Yes, the corona streamers indicate that the coil is working well and is at or near resonance. But perhaps it needs a bit more terminal capacitance. A slightly larger cabinet knob or small toroid on the top might reduce the corona and allow a stronger main discharge.

    Definitely one of the very best tiny TCs I've seen.
